Cost effective accommodation conveniently located from Airport and City. Public transport was convenient (from airport: 901 bus and 902 bus changing over at Broadmeadows station and from city: train to Broadmeadows station and then 902 bus. There is also train to Gowrie but I did not use this as down for maintenance). Close to Coles / Aldi / Kmart at Campbellfield which is also where the bus stop is (at Mahoneys Rd).
There is no lift so if you're disabled, best to take the lower level. I stayed in room 312 - there's a huge crack in the corner near the door that management will want to look at - I think the spring on the door is causing slamming too hard.

When are the check-in and check-out times for ibis Budget - Fawkner?
Please note, when staying at ibis Budget - Fawkner, the check-in times are from 12:00 PM up to 10:00 PM and check-out should be completed by 10:00 AM.
Is vehicle parking offered by ibis Budget - Fawkner?
Yes, there is free private on-site parking available at ibis Budget - Fawkner.
What's the nightly rate at ibis Budget - Fawkner?
ibis Budget - Fawkner has a starting price of $50 for accommodations. Do remember that actual rates might deviate based on the room and date. Insert your dates for a detailed price view.
Which room categories can I book at ibis Budget - Fawkner?
The ibis Budget - Fawkner offers a variety of room types including Standard Twin Rooms with 2 twin beds and Standard Queen Rooms with a Queen size bed. Smoking is not allowed in any of the rooms. Occupancy ranges from 2 adults and 1 child in most rooms to 3 adults and 2 children in the Queen Room with Bunk Bed. Room sizes are around 129 sqft.
